public class TracingJMSProducer extends Object implements javax.jms.JMSProducer
| Constructor and Description |
|---|
TracingJMSProducer(javax.jms.JMSProducer jmsProducer,
javax.jms.JMSContext jmsContext,
io.opentracing.Tracer tracer) |
TracingJMSProducer(javax.jms.JMSProducer jmsProducer,
javax.jms.Session jmsSession,
io.opentracing.Tracer tracer) |
| Modifier and Type | Method and Description |
|---|---|
javax.jms.JMSProducer |
clearProperties() |
javax.jms.CompletionListener |
getAsync() |
boolean |
getBooleanProperty(String arg0) |
byte |
getByteProperty(String arg0) |
long |
getDeliveryDelay() |
int |
getDeliveryMode() |
boolean |
getDisableMessageID() |
boolean |
getDisableMessageTimestamp() |
double |
getDoubleProperty(String arg0) |
float |
getFloatProperty(String arg0) |
int |
getIntProperty(String arg0) |
String |
getJMSCorrelationID() |
byte[] |
getJMSCorrelationIDAsBytes() |
javax.jms.Destination |
getJMSReplyTo() |
String |
getJMSType() |
long |
getLongProperty(String arg0) |
Object |
getObjectProperty(String arg0) |
int |
getPriority() |
Set<String> |
getPropertyNames() |
short |
getShortProperty(String arg0) |
String |
getStringProperty(String arg0) |
long |
getTimeToLive() |
boolean |
propertyExists(String arg0) |
javax.jms.JMSProducer |
send(javax.jms.Destination destination,
byte[] arg1) |
javax.jms.JMSProducer |
send(javax.jms.Destination destination,
Map<String,Object> arg1) |
javax.jms.JMSProducer |
send(javax.jms.Destination destination,
javax.jms.Message message) |
javax.jms.JMSProducer |
send(javax.jms.Destination destination,
Serializable obj) |
javax.jms.JMSProducer |
send(javax.jms.Destination destination,
String message) |
javax.jms.JMSProducer |
setAsync(javax.jms.CompletionListener arg0) |
javax.jms.JMSProducer |
setDeliveryDelay(long arg0) |
javax.jms.JMSProducer |
setDeliveryMode(int arg0) |
javax.jms.JMSProducer |
setDisableMessageID(boolean arg0) |
javax.jms.JMSProducer |
setDisableMessageTimestamp(boolean arg0) |
javax.jms.JMSProducer |
setJMSCorrelationID(String arg0) |
javax.jms.JMSProducer |
setJMSCorrelationIDAsBytes(byte[] arg0) |
javax.jms.JMSProducer |
setJMSReplyTo(javax.jms.Destination destination) |
javax.jms.JMSProducer |
setJMSType(String arg0) |
javax.jms.JMSProducer |
setPriority(int arg0) |
javax.jms.JMSProducer |
setProperty(String arg0,
boolean ar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
byte ar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
double ar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
float ar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
int ar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
long ar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
Object ar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
short arg1) |
javax.jms.JMSProducer |
setProperty(String arg0,
String arg1) |
javax.jms.JMSProducer |
setTimeToLive(long arg0) |
public TracingJMSProducer(javax.jms.JMSProducer jmsProducer,
javax.jms.JMSContext jmsContext,
io.opentracing.Tracer tracer)
public TracingJMSProducer(javax.jms.JMSProducer jmsProducer,
javax.jms.Session jmsSession,
io.opentracing.Tracer tracer)
public javax.jms.JMSProducer clearProperties()
clearProperties in interface javax.jms.JMSProducerpublic javax.jms.CompletionListener getAsync()
getAsync in interface javax.jms.JMSProducerpublic boolean getBooleanProperty(String arg0)
getBooleanProperty in interface javax.jms.JMSProducerpublic byte getByteProperty(String arg0)
getByteProperty in interface javax.jms.JMSProducerpublic long getDeliveryDelay()
getDeliveryDelay in interface javax.jms.JMSProducerpublic int getDeliveryMode()
getDeliveryMode in interface javax.jms.JMSProducerpublic boolean getDisableMessageID()
getDisableMessageID in interface javax.jms.JMSProducerpublic boolean getDisableMessageTimestamp()
getDisableMessageTimestamp in interface javax.jms.JMSProducerpublic double getDoubleProperty(String arg0)
getDoubleProperty in interface javax.jms.JMSProducerpublic float getFloatProperty(String arg0)
getFloatProperty in interface javax.jms.JMSProducerpublic int getIntProperty(String arg0)
getIntProperty in interface javax.jms.JMSProducerpublic String getJMSCorrelationID()
getJMSCorrelationID in interface javax.jms.JMSProducerpublic byte[] getJMSCorrelationIDAsBytes()
getJMSCorrelationIDAsBytes in interface javax.jms.JMSProducerpublic javax.jms.Destination getJMSReplyTo()
getJMSReplyTo in interface javax.jms.JMSProducerpublic String getJMSType()
getJMSType in interface javax.jms.JMSProducerpublic long getLongProperty(String arg0)
getLongProperty in interface javax.jms.JMSProducerpublic Object getObjectProperty(String arg0)
getObjectProperty in interface javax.jms.JMSProducerpublic int getPriority()
getPriority in interface javax.jms.JMSProducerpublic Set<String> getPropertyNames()
getPropertyNames in interface javax.jms.JMSProducerpublic short getShortProperty(String arg0)
getShortProperty in interface javax.jms.JMSProducerpublic String getStringProperty(String arg0)
getStringProperty in interface javax.jms.JMSProducerpublic long getTimeToLive()
getTimeToLive in interface javax.jms.JMSProducerpublic boolean propertyExists(String arg0)
propertyExists in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er send(javax.jms.Destination destination,
javax.jms.Message message)
send in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er send(javax.jms.Destination destination,
String message)
send in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er send(javax.jms.Destination destination,
Map<String,Object> arg1)
send in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er send(javax.jms.Destination destination,
byte[] arg1)
send in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er send(javax.jms.Destination destination,
Serializable obj)
send in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setAsync(javax.jms.CompletionListener arg0)
setAsync in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setDeliveryDelay(long arg0)
setDeliveryDelay in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setDeliveryMode(int arg0)
setDeliveryMode in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setDisableMessageID(boolean arg0)
setDisableMessageID in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setDisableMessageTimestamp(boolean arg0)
setDisableMessageTimestamp in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setJMSCorrelationID(String arg0)
setJMSCorrelationID in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setJMSCorrelationIDAsBytes(byte[] arg0)
setJMSCorrelationIDAsBytes in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setJMSReplyTo(javax.jms.Destination destination)
setJMSReplyTo in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setJMSType(String arg0)
setJMSType in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setPriority(int arg0)
setPriority in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, boolean ar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, byte ar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, short ar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, int ar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, long ar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, float ar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, double ar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, String ar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setProperty(String arg0, Object arg1)
setProperty in interface javax.jms.JMSProducerpublic javax.jms.JMSProducer setTimeToLive(long arg0)
setTimeToLive in interface javax.jms.JMSProducerCopyright © 2017-2019–2019. All rights reserved.